MUMBAI, INDIA - In a major move to emphasize safety amidst soaring growth, the Indian Association of Amusement Parks and Industries (IAAPI) will host the first-ever Safety Conclave during the 24th IAAPI Amusement Expo. Scheduled for March 12, 2026, at the Bombay Exhibition Centre, the conclave aims to set a new industry benchmark.
The need for a dedicated safety dialogue has never been greater, with the amusement sector experiencing unprecedented footfalls. As a response, IAAPI will make the conclave a staple of all future expos, ensuring industry-wide adoption of enhanced safety measures. The event promises to be a turning point, redefining how facilities prioritize guest and operational safety.
Participants will benefit from a masterclass led by seasoned instructors and experts, who will share strategies on risk assessment, design safety, fire mitigation, and more. Established in 1999, IAAPI is committed to fostering operational excellence and stringent safety standards as the sector evolves.
